Genk star Joseph Paintsil waves magic to help Black Stars clinch slender win against Angola in Kumasi —

Marquee Ghana attacker Joseph Paintsil waved his magic as he set up Antoine Semenyo in the 96th minute to score the winning goal for the Black Stars.

Paintsil, 25, replaced Crystal Palace forward Jordan Ayew with 21 minutes of normal time on the clock.

With the clock ticking for Chris Hughton’s side, it took the Genk star to appear on the scene to stir up the goal area of the Palancas Negras.

The ex-Tema Youth man, who has 12 goals in 26 games for Genk this season, pressed and persevered in the area as he committed Adilson Cipriano Da Cruz in the Angolan goalpost.

He then squared the ball for Semenyo who was in a better position to smash the ball home for the winner.
